Raytheon's Effector Analog & Power (EAP) team is responsible for the development, from concept to integration, of Telemetry and Flight Termination products; power systems from all up round to the lowest level power regulation; servo electronics supporting all mechanical motion in our products and low noise mixed signal electronics that provides the analog to digital interface to our front-end sensors. Raytheon is seeking a Senior Hardware Lab Lead to manage and implement environmental test projects, as well as oversee the day-to-day administrative functions of multiple engineering and environmental test labs. This role will focus on ensuring safety, security, and compliance in alignment with established doctrine and governance. What You Will Do
Lab Operating Procedure (LOP) Management; provide direction for lab users on established policies. Management, coordination, and implementation of Environmental Health and Safety standards. Ensure company and customer owned property is properly tracked, managed, and calibrated. Maintain and improve the lab access list and training matrices, ensuring all personnel entering the labs are properly trained and cleared. Uphold company policies and practices to ensure compliance and provide a safe and secure lab environment. Take a proactive role in developing, understanding, and implementing common lab processes, tools, templates, and metrics. Communicate issues and opportunities for improvement to team members and management. Oversee audit assessment preparation; Engineering Lab Objective Evaluation and Factory & Lab Assessment reviews; develop corrective action plans and assist in the development of long-range objectives. Safeguard classified/proprietary material, hardware, and documentation.
